Former Blues defender Peter Clarke says Goodison Park will “always be the home of Everton” but hopes the move to Bramley-Moore Dock will have a positive impact.
“An incredible place, steeped in history,” Clarke said on BBC Radio Merseyside. “Every time I ever played there I loved it – the feeling that you got from the fans.
“I love the fact the supporters were so close to the pitch. With some of the modern stadiums now, fans are a considerable distance from the playing area. I love the fact that they were so close and the atmosphere that created.
“There are not many games left there now and time will probably pass very quickly between now and the end of the season. It will be sad to see it not be the home of the club anymore.
“I think it will always be the home of Everton but the opportunity to move to a new stadium and everything that will bring will hopefully have a really positive impact on things.”
